The Swine Diagnostic Test Kit Market has experienced significant growth in recent years, driven by increasing intensification of pig production systems, rising threat of African swine fever and other devastating viral diseases, and growing demand for rapid, accurate pathogen detection to protect herd health and food security. These specialized diagnostic tools enable veterinarians and producers to identify bacterial, viral, and parasitic infections affecting swine populations, facilitating timely intervention through targeted treatment, vaccination, or biosecurity measures. Pork producers, veterinary laboratories, and regulatory agencies increasingly rely on point-of-care and laboratory-based test kits to monitor disease status, certify health for trade, and support eradication programs.
The Swine Diagnostic Test Kit Market continues expanding due to rising global pork consumption driving production scale, growing antibiotic resistance concerns necessitating evidence-based treatment decisions, and advancing molecular diagnostic technologies including real-time PCR, ELISA, and lateral flow assays. Manufacturers develop improved multiplex panels detecting multiple pathogens simultaneously, pen-side rapid tests enabling immediate on-farm decisions, and serological assays monitoring herd immunity and vaccine efficacy. The market benefits from expanding veterinary infrastructure in emerging pork-producing regions, government biosecurity investments protecting national herds, and increasing integration of diagnostics into precision livestock management platforms.

Q: What major pathogens do swine diagnostic kits detect? A: African swine fever virus, porcine reproductive and respiratory syndrome virus, classical swine fever, porcine epidemic diarrhea virus, Mycoplasma hyopneumoniae, Actinobacillus pleuropneumoniae, and Salmonella species represent critical targets.
Q: How are molecular diagnostics improving swine disease management? A: Real-time PCR and isothermal amplification technologies provide rapid, highly specific pathogen identification enabling immediate quarantine, culling decisions, and prevention of catastrophic herd losses and regional spread.
